Hotel California by the Sea’s drug detox in Orange County is the first step towards sobriety. Drug detoxification is the process of removing harmful substances (drugs and alcohol) from a person’s body. Detoxing from substances such as opiates, benzos and alcohol can be incredibly difficult because the person is physically dependent on them. Because these substances can be extremely addictive, detoxing without medical supervision can be dangerous and sometimes life-threatening.
Detox is the initial period of rehab in which patients participate in medical treatments to overcome their dependency on drugs and alcohol. At our drug and alcohol detox in Orange County, the timeline for drug removal will depend on each patient. Contributing factors for the length of treatment include the severity of their addiction and progress as evaluated by our rehab clinicians.
Patients seeking medical detox in Orange County suffer from Substance Use Disorder (SUD). This is a mental health condition in which users are unable to control urges to use drugs and alcohol, despite repeated negative consequences. These substances ultimately alter a person’s brain functions, resulting in abnormal and potentially dangerous behavior.

Customized Substance Detox in Orange County at Hotel California by the Sea
As the first step in the drug detox process, patients are immediately given a biopsychosocial assessment (BPS). This routine procedure helps determine if any biological, psychological or social factors contribute to the client’s drug and alcohol addiction.
At our Orange County opiate detox center, an in-depth health and medical history of each client is evaluated. This allows clinicians to create an effective treatment plan for drug or alcohol detox. Clients will be assigned a clinical team that will help ensure their specific needs are addressed throughout the duration of drug detox in Orange County.
Our drug and alcohol detox in Orange County is Incidental Medical Services (IMS) certified. Our IMS services offer a full spectrum of evidence-based treatments for drug and alcohol recovery. We provide consistent monitoring of each patient’s progress during the detox and withdrawal period.
Patients will receive daily assessments with a medical doctor. This will allow for adjusted tapers and other medications accordingly. Nurses and other medical staff at the alcohol detox in Orange County are available around the clock to check in with patients every four hours. This helps to ensure each patient is comfortable and safe during this vulnerable and critical process.

Medication Assisted Treatment
The usage of FDA-approved medications to aid in drug detox in Orange County, is common practice in addiction treatment. At our Orange County rehab, Medication-Assisted Therapy (MAT) is a popular treatment for those suffering from both a substance use disorder (SUD) and an alcohol use disorder (AUD).
Withdrawal from certain substances can be uncomfortable and even dangerous if not treated properly. MAT is often used to help patients detox more comfortably from addictive substances. With MAT, patients are prescribed specific doses of medication to help them safely remove addictive substances from their bodies.
Our drug and alcohol detox in Orange County provides MAT to aid our patients in their transition to sobriety. We also offer other forms of medication-based therapies with the help of professional addiction experts.
Common medications used in our alcohol detox in Orange County:
- Naltrexone – a drug used to help reduce alcohol cravings because it physically stimulates withdrawal symptoms. These unpleasant withdrawal symptoms are supposed to deter the patient from turning to their cravings.
- Acamprosate – this drug is used to help patients reduce alcohol cravings and is usually administered after the initial alcohol detox has been completed.
- Disulfiram – this drug is similar to Acamprosate in that it produces severe physical reactions when alcohol is consumed. Some symptoms that occur include nausea, headaches and low blood pressure.
Common medications used in our drug detox in Orange County:
Taper Medications:
- Suboxone – This drug is often administered to help suppress cravings and normal withdrawal symptoms associated with those suffering from severe opiate addiction.
- Valium – This Benzodiazepine is used to reduce anxiety associated with detox from substances such as alcohol and opioids. Benzos are administered carefully because they are very potent and can also become addictive.
- Lucemyra – This drug is prescribed to help reduce symptoms related to opioid withdrawal.
Comfort Medications:
- Clonidine – This drug is used to reduce symptoms of anxiety, sweating and abnormally fast heart rate.
- Hydroxyzine – This is an antihistamine and is used to help with the tension and anxiety often associated with substance withdrawal.
- Propranolol – This medication is similar to Clonidine and is prescribed to reduce symptoms of tremors and irregular heartbeat.
How it works: Our drug detox in Orange County
The detox process at our drug detox center in Orange County is generally categorized into three different phases: Intake, Medication and Stabilization. The best interest of the patient is taken into consideration in order to smoothly and safely guide them throughout detox. At our drug and alcohol detox in Orange County, each patient is monitored and given the most effective treatment.
Intake
During the intake step, the medical team will perform physical and emotional assessments of the patient. All aspects of the patient’s condition will be taken into consideration when building a comprehensive care plan. This includes a complete medical history as well as a family history of addiction.
This is the first step towards a healthy life free of alcohol. Medical physicians will work with patients and assess the appropriate detox method followed by individualized counseling and therapy. A carefully crafted treatment plan is important to successfully detox from a widely abused substance such as alcohol.
Medication
Next, patients are then subjected to carefully monitored and prescribed doses of medications to help assist in the initial detox. Withdrawal symptoms during detox can be severe. Attention and medical care are important to the health and well-being of the patient during this critical step. Medications can also help target co-occurring disorders such as depression and anxiety, which are often associated with drug and alcohol addiction.
The medications used during alcohol detox are approved by medical physicians to successfully assist in withdrawal management. Physical symptoms such as tremors, elevated heart rate and hallucinations can be painful. But under the care of experienced detox physicians, more intense symptoms can be safely managed.
Stabilization
In the final phase, the stabilization process focuses on continuing treatment after drug detox has been achieved. Patients will move on to other treatments meant to ensure that substances will no longer be a dependency. During this final step in the detox process, patients undergo counseling and therapy. This helps treat the emotional and psychological damage associated with their addiction. Group therapy and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y have been proven to yield successful results in the treatment of drug and alcohol addiction. The goal of stabilization is to get the patient clean of alcohol and ready to take the next step into sober living.
Orange County Opiate Detox
The length of drug detox in Orange County can depend on many factors. Some of these factors include the type of addictive substance that has been abused and how often they were abused. Any underlying co-occurring mental health issues as well as the person’s medical history should also be taken into consideration. Our rehab center also specializes in treating targeted drugs such as opioids and heroin addiction.
Detox from heroin can take a few days. Detoxing from the cravings to use the substance can take much longer. The entire process of detox can range from a few days to a few months. A typical heroin detox program typically ranges from five to seven days.
For stimulant drugs, withdrawal symptoms can appear within a few hours and last for a few days. The drug cravings from stimulants can continue for months after the initial detox. For sedative drugs, depending on which substance has been abused, detox could take anywhere from five days to a few weeks.
For opioids, detox can typically last between five to seven days. However, for those who are battling severe opioid addiction, withdrawal symptoms could go on for more than 6 months.
